What is the most dangerous lake in Georgia?

Lake Lanier: Georgia’s most popular—and dangerous—lake. Lake Lanier is a reservoir created by the dammed-up Chattahoochee River.

What is the deadliest lake in Georgia?

Lake Lanier is a man-made lake built in the 1950s. In the process, several grave sites were dug up, leading to folklore claiming it is haunted—and even cursed. Potentially hauntings aside, Lake Lanier is one of America’s most deadly lakes.

Whats the cleanest lake in Georgia?

Lake Sinclair is one of the cleanest lakes in Georgia. There are no eating restrictions on the fish caught out of Lake Sinclair. Water clarity on Lake Sinclair varies depending on location. This is a mud, sand & rock bottom lake and is not as clear as rock bottom lakes found in the mountains.

What is the deadliest lake in the US?

Lake Michigan

This lake is consistently named the deadliest in the U.S., even though it is a popular swimming attraction for both visitors and locals. Unfortunately, Lake Michigan has an extremely strong undercurrent that is responsible for several deaths each year.

How many dead bodies are in Lake Lanier?

Historians say some unmarked graves and other structures were swallowed up by its waters. More than 200 people have died in swimming and boating accidents on the lake since 1994, adding to its dark history.

Is there a cemetery under Lake Lanier?

It is estimated that nearly twenty cemeteries were impacted by the creation of Lake Lanier. Cemeteries were moved to higher ground in areas around the lake’s future boundaries. … The maps show elevations, future islands, and the boundaries of the lake after a “maximum power pool” of 1,070 feet.

Are there alligators in Lake Lanier 2020?

An alligator, which is estimated to be about 2-to-3-feet long, has been seen on the north end of Lake Lanier near Don Carter State Park. According to the Georgia Department of Natural Resources, while the gator does not pose a threat to public, people should still give the animal space.

How many people have died at Lake Lanier 2018?

According to the Georgia Department of Natural Resources Law Enforcement Division: Lake Lanier experienced 57 boating fatalities and 145 drownings between 1999 and 2018.

Are there crocodiles in Georgia?

Georgia is home to only one, the American alligator (Alligator mississippiensis). Only two other species occur in North America – the native American crocodile (Crocodylus acutus ) found in extreme southern Florida and the spectacled caiman (Caiman crocodilus ), an introduced species.
